White Mold Mitigation in Fort Worth, TX
White mold mitigation services focus on identifying and removing mold growth that appears as a white, powdery or fuzzy substance on surfaces within a property. These services typically address mold issues caused by excess moisture in areas such as bathrooms, basements, attics, or behind walls. Property owners often seek this service to improve indoor air quality, prevent structural damage, and eliminate health concerns associated with mold exposure. Before requesting mitigation, homeowners usually want to understand the scope of contamination, the potential causes of moisture buildup, and the steps involved in safely removing the mold to prevent recurrence.
Projects covered by white mold mitigation include cleaning affected surfaces, treating areas with mold-resistant solutions, and addressing underlying moisture issues to prevent future growth. Property owners should be aware that successful mitigation often requires thorough inspection and proper removal techniques to ensure mold spores are contained and eliminated. Understanding the extent of the mold growth and the potential need for repairs or improvements to ventilation and moisture control can help in planning effective solutions and maintaining a healthy indoor environment.

Common White Mold Mitigation Jobs
White Mold Remediation - removal of mold growth from affected areas to improve indoor air quality.
Structural Drying - drying out walls, ceilings, and floors impacted by mold-related moisture.
Mold Inspection - identifying the extent and source of mold growth within the property.
Surface Cleaning - cleaning and sanitizing surfaces to prevent mold spores from spreading.
Moisture Control - addressing leaks and humidity issues to inhibit future mold growth.
Preventative Treatments - applying solutions to reduce the chance of mold returning after mitigation.
White Mold Mitigation Questions
What is white mold? White mold is a type of mold that appears as a white or light-colored growth on surfaces, often in damp or humid areas of a property.
How does white mold affect a property? White mold can cause property damage and may impact indoor air quality, potentially leading to health concerns for occupants.
What are common areas where white mold is found? White mold often develops on walls, ceilings, bathrooms, basements, and around leaks or water damage.
How is white mold typically removed? Removal involves cleaning affected surfaces and addressing underlying moisture issues to prevent future growth.
